Mohammad Ashraf Kichhouchhwi made new president of AIUMB

    By TwoCircles.net staff reporter,

    Lucknow: All India Ulema & Mashaikh Board (AIUMB), premier body of Barelvi Muslims have promoted its General Secretary to the President post. In a meeting held in Amethi on the eve of last Sunday’s Sunni Conference, Syed Mohammad Ashraf Kichhouchhwi has been made the president of the party. The Core Committee of the AIUMB made Babar Ashraf the new General Secretary, he was earlier serving as the National Secretary of the organization.

    Later thousands attended the Sunni Conference at Amethi, far below the expected lakhs that AIUMB hoped to attract.



    The growth of extremism in the country was the main subject along with representation of Sunni Sufi Muslims in Muslim bodies like Hajj Committees and Waqf boards and government bodies requiring Muslim participation like Maulana Azad Education Foundation and Minority Finance and Developmental Corporation.

    Hazrat Maulana syed Mohammad Ashraf Kichchauchvi said that it is known that the khanqahs, Aastanas and Dargahs are spiritual centers that are revered by all including non Muslims and so heads of the spiritual centers found it necessary to come out to save the country and the community from an extreme alien ideology which is destroying the social fabric and creating social He was critical of government apathy towards the community which boasts to be the second largest Muslim population in the world.



    Maulana said that the time has come when the union and state governments will have to change their view and stop seeing Muslim issues from the eyes of Wahabi/Salafi elements who have grabbed high positions in Muslim bodies and government bodies requiring Muslim participation.

    The conference was addressed by Syed Mehdi Mian and Syed Abdur Rab (Chand Mian) MaulanaAnsar Raza, Syed Sayedul Anwar Syedi Mian, Maulana Junaid Khan, Maulana Syed Alamgir Ashraf, Maulana Nooruddin Asdaq, Maulana Shakil Misbahi, Syed Aamir Masoodi, Syed Tanvir Hashimi.
